Brick stoop rep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the front steps made from brick or similar masonry materials. Over time, exposure to weather, foot traffic, and natural settling can cause brick stoops to develop cracks, chips, or uneven surfaces. Repair work typically involves replacing damaged bricks, filling in cracks, and leveling the surface to ensure the stoop remains safe and visually appealing.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to match the existing brickwork and preserve the overall aesthetic of the property’s entrance.
Many common problems signal the need for brick stoop repair. Cracks that expand or appear suddenly can compromise the structural integrity of the steps. Loose or shifting bricks may create tripping hazards, especially for visitors or residents. Additionally, water infiltration through damaged mortar or cracks can lead to further deterioration, including crumbling brick or foundational issues. Addressing these problems early can prevent more costly repairs down the line and help maintain the property's cur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Brick Stoop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Des Moines, IA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many routine brick stoop repairs in West Des Moines typ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ects often involve replacing a few damaged bricks or repointing mortar joints and are common for homeowners addressing minor issues.
Moderate Restoration - Larger repairs, such as rebuilding sections of a stoop or replacing multiple bricks, generally fall in the range of $600 to $1,500. Many local contractors handle these projects regularly, which tend to be more predictable in cost.
Full Replacement - Completely replacing a brick stoop can range from $1,500 to $4,000 depending on size and complexity.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this range, which is usually reserved for more intricate or custom designs.
Complex or Custom Projects - Extensive or highly customized brick stoop work, such as incorporating decorative elements or structural reinforcements,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es brick stoops to become damaged? Brick stoops can suffer damage from freeze-thaw cycles, moisture infiltration, or shifting ground, leading to cracks or deterioration.
How can I tell if my brick stoop needs repair? Signs include cracked or loose bricks, uneven surfaces, or crumbling mortar, which indicate the need for professional assessment.
What types of repairs are available for brick stoops? Repairs may involve replacing damaged bricks, repointing mortar joints, or leveling uneven surfaces to restore stability and appearance.
Are there different repair options depending on the extent of damage? Yes, minor cracks might be sealed, while more extensive damage could require partial or full replacement of bricks and structural reinforcement.
